SP passes BacCHP ordinance

December 8, 2022

The proposed ordinance establishing the guidelines and procedures in the availment of the Bacolod Comprehensive Health Program (BacCHP), and allocating P80-million for its initial implementation, was approved on third and final reading by the Sangguniang Panlungsod, Wednesday, Dec. 7.

Bacolod SP approves P3.25-B budget for 2023

December 8, 2022

The P3.250 billion General Fund Budget of the Bacolod City government for 2023 was approved by the Sangguniang Panlungsod on third and final reading during its regular session Wednesday, Dec. 7.

Negros Weekly news magazine was founded on November 11, 2000 by a group of civic leaders and local journalists headed by Journalism Professor Allen V. Del Carmen. The publication offers news, features, and opinion articles for Negros Occidental readers. It also accepts printing jobs, graphic designs, legal notices and ad placements.*
